What is South by Southwest?

Le South by Southwest Festival is an annual event held in Austin, Texas, that celebrates the convergence of the cultural and creative industries (including film and music) and technology. Launched in 1987 by Roland Swenson, Louis Black, Nick Barbaro, and Louis Meyers, the event initially focused on music and aimed to showcase Austin's eclectic music scene. Organizers later added film and interactive components, making the South by southwest a major multidisciplinary event. The name of the festival is also a nod to the film " North by Northwest » by Alfred Hitchcock.
From 700 participants in its first edition to more than 345 in the 000 edition, SXSW has seen its attendance grow exponentially and now brings together more than 100 countries around concerts and screenings. The festival has often hosted the premiere of notable films such as " Everything Everywhere All at Once » by Daniel Kwan and Daniel Scheinert, « A Quiet Place » by John Krasinski, « Ready Player One » by Steven Spielberg or « The Cabin in the Woods » by Drew Goddard. « South by » is also the venue for conferences and panels by notable personalities: Barack Obama and Lady Gaga have already participated in the festival, attracting worldwide media attention and illustrating the artistic and cultural, tech, entrepreneurial and inspiring dimensions of the event.
For tech entrepreneurs, SXSW is the ideal place to announce innovations that will change the face of the world and to present their expert and forward-looking point of view. As during the 2023 edition where Greg Brockman, president and co-founder of OpenAI, shared his vision of an artificial intelligence beneficial to humanity without denying the upheavals that it could cause in many sectors. He had then underlined the importance of educating the general public on the capabilities and limits of this technology and called for appropriate regulations. This was a few days before the launch of GPT-4.

What to expect for SXSW 2025?

Each year, Amy Webb, CEO of the Future Today Institute, opens the ball of innovation celebrations with a highly anticipated conference, one that sets the tone and a sharp vision of the major tech trends to follow. Last year, the person concerned set the scene for the " technology supercycle " in front of which we stand: artificial intelligence, ecosystem of connected objects (IoT), biotech, Gen T (generation transition), organoid intelligence, " makers » vs « talkers "... His speech, again highly anticipated this year, should focus on new trends in AI and their impact on society, the future of the internet and the technologies that will shape it, and the implications of these technological advances for businesses and individuals.
